Solution Overview
Problem
Current systems fail to effectively entice consumers to visit or enter merchant shops and improve consumer-merchant interactions, lacking personalized promotional offers based on proximity to communication beacons.
Innovation Solution
A system utilizing communication beacons and servers to detect consumer devices' proximity, providing personalized promotions, menu data, and merchant information, both inside and outside the shop, through direct wireless connections, and enabling seamless transactions and reviews.

Systems and related methods of providing promotions to consumers based on proximity to communication beacons are discussed herein. Some embodiments may provide for a system including a communication beacon and a central system. The communication beacon may be associated with a merchant and located at a merchant shop. Based on receiving consumer presence data from the communication beacon indicating that a consumer device and the communication beacon has formed a direct wireless connection, the server may be configured to provide merchant information, promotions, or other messages to the consumer device. In some embodiments, messages may be generated by the merchant and targeted to consumers based on consumer device location, consumer demographics, among other things. Furthermore, the server may provide consumer information to a merchant device to facilitate consumer service, point-of-sale, and seamless transactions and promotion redemptions.
